Exceptions: EECS 312, EECS 330, EECS 361 EECS 388, and EECS 468, may be taken in the same semester as students are completing their upper level eligibility. Students may also petition for a Partial Waiver of Upper Level Eligibility Requirements by completing the appropriate petition, found in the EECS office or at www.eecs.ku.edu.

Find EECS study guides, notes, and practice tests for KU.EECS 388. Embedded Systems. 4 Credits. This course will address internal organization of micro-controller systems, sometimes called embedded systems, used in a wide variety of engineered systems: programming in C and assembly language; input and output systems; collecting data from sensors; and controlling external devices.19-Oct-2017 ... The Electrical Engineering and Computer Science Department offers two Master's level programs: a single coursework-only Master's of Engineering (M.Eng.) in EECS degree program, and three separate Master's of Science (M.S.) degree programs in Computer Science, Computer Engineering and Electrical Engineering.

JUNIORS and SENIORS in KU EECS are encouraged to apply for Early Application into the M.S. or Ph.D. Program (Early Application is available for the M.S. thesis and Ph.D. program). Students admitted to the Early Application program receive a six hour credit reduction upon admission, rewarding them for their exceptional preparation.
